"LIKE" Documentary Community Screening April 14

The Solvay Union Free School District invites our community to a powerful evening dedicated to helping our children thrive—both online and offlineThis event is designed to help parents navigate the complexities of social media and its impact on student well-being.


Join us for a screening of the documentary LIKE, followed by a discussion on how digital platforms influence children's mental health, behavior, and emotional development.  Click here to watch a trailer for the film.

To ensure a shared foundation for conversation at home:

  • Solvay High School students have previously viewed and discussed the film.
  • Solvay Middle School students will participate in a school-day viewing prior to our community event.LIKE - A DOCUMENTARY ABOUT THE IMPACT OF SOCIAL MEDIA ON OUR LIVES BANNER

Event Details

  • When: April 14th 

  • Time: 6:00-8:00pm

  • Where: Solvay High School Auditorium 

Light refreshments will be offered.


What You Will Gain

This session aims to provide families with practical support and clear takeaways:

  • Practical Strategies: Effective methods for managing screen time.

  • Communication Tools: Guidance on how to talk to kids about social media.

  • Safety Awareness: Recognizing the warning signs of unhealthy online use.

  • Community Support: Access to helpful school and community resources.
